About This Opportunity

The NASA Postdoctoral Program (NPP) offers unique research opportunities to highly-talented scientists to engage in ongoing NASA research projects. This specific opportunity focuses on understanding the solar origins of space weather and other energetic solar phenomena through data interpretation, theory, and numerical simulations. Research areas include magnetic reconnection in the Sun's atmosphere, formation and evolution of filament channels, coronal mass ejections, chromospheric and coronal jets, coronal heating, prominence plasmas, flare reconnection, and heliospheric current sheet dynamics. These competitive fellowships are one- to three-year appointments designed to advance NASA's missions in space science, Earth science, aeronautics, space operations, exploration systems, and astrobiology. Fellows work at NASA Goddard Space Flight Center in Greenbelt, Maryland, collaborating with leading scientists in heliophysics research.
